Hi everyone,
this is my first post here and I hope I set it in the right category. I am working on an older oscilloscope at the moment. A Philips PM 3340. The Power Supply is down, I have figured out some defect components by now for example bad npn power tranni and a high voltage diode and... maybe an inductor. Here is my problem by the look of it I am pretty sure it is an inductor but what value? I looked through the common color code charts but couldn't find this color combination. White Blue Green , so 9 | 6 | and then? Green as a multiplier seems very high to me and is listed nowhere on the color code charts.

Can anyone help me?
